Newark introduces new economic development manager, promoted IT analyst and two dispatchers
The Newark City Council recognized several recent hires and an internal promotion during its presentations segment.

Presiding official introduced Angela Sui to the council as a recent addition in economic development, citing more than 20 years of public-sector economic development experience in Northern California and a bachelor's degree from the University of California. The presiding official said Sui has worked in cities including Walnut Creek and Cupertino.

The council also announced that Narayan Krishman was recently promoted to senior IT analyst. The presentation noted Krishman's computer-science degree and prior work at Hewlett Packard Labs and local education offices, as well as contributions to improving the city's data network.

Two new public-safety dispatchers were welcomed: Missy Gallardo (hired 01/30/2024), a Newark native and graduate of Newark Memorial High School who completed the Newark Police Department Citizens Police Academy, and Erica de Guzman Quintero (hired 08/05/2024), who previously worked in San Leandro's building division and studied at Laney and Chabot Colleges.

The presiding official asked the audience to join in welcoming the new staff and praised the quality and experience of recent hires.
